Although I would love to highlight many of the new Native American picture books published this year, that will have to wait a few months yet since I’m on the Caldecott Committee for the 2026 award. I am not able to post about eligible 2025 picture books until after the awards are announced on January 26th, and since every book published in the U.S. with an illustrator who is an American citizen or resident is eligible for award consideration, it’s better to just avoid all of them for a little bit longer. But I don’t want us to forget about all of the wonderful picture books we’ve discovered in previous years we could still be sharing this month!
